Phacelia purshii Buckley and P. fimbriata Micheaux are two species that are nearly morphologically indistinguishable. Seed germination experiments showed that the high elevation endemic, P. fimbriata requires lower temperatures to trigger germination. Following interspecific crosses, pollen tubes enter ovules and maternal tissue of the gynoecium matures but hybrid diploid and triploid organs fail to develop. DNA sequences from the ribosomal DNA internal transcribed region showed that P. fimbriata and P. purshii comprise a monophyletic clade but that P. fimbriata is more differentiated from related species. Regional integration of potato and dairy farms has developed in Maine through arrangements where manure, feed, and sometimes land, are exchanged between neighboring farms. The effects of integration on soil quality, crop production, nitrogen (N) cycling, and N loss were investigated in field and laboratory studies of contrasting amended (manure, compost, green manure, and supplemental fertilizer) and nonamended (fertilizer only) soil management systems within 2-year potato (Solanum tuberosum L.) rotations in the Maine Potato Cropping Systems Project (MPEP). Native to the southeastern United States, variable-leaf watermilfoil (Myriophyllum heterophyllum) is an invasive species in the Northeast and has been documented in Maine lakes for twenty years. Variable-leaf watermilfoil is targeted by the Maine Department of Environmental Protection as a species of grave concern as it has aggressively colonized twenty-six water bodies in Maine. This aquatic invasive plant grows in dense mats and outcompetes native vegetation. It is causing both ecological and economic disruption to Maine's lakes and ponds. Based on molecular phylogenetic analyses, the polyphyletic order Chytridiales, one of the four orders in the Chytridiomycota, contains several well-supported clades. One species, Chytriomyces angularis, however, does not group within the robust clades of the Chytridiales or any other chytrid order. The light-level morphology and zoospore ultrastructure of this aquatic species also differ from those of the type species of the genus Chytriomyces. The response of red raspberry (Rubus idaeus) plants to the loss of flower buds through the feeding and oviposition activities of the strawberry bud weevil (Anthonomus signatus), and the potential impact of this bud loss on fruit yield and quality, was studied through greenhouse and field experiments. With two cultivars of raspberry (‘Killarney’ and ‘Encore’) grown in a greenhouse, manual clipping of flower buds to simulate strawberry bud weevil (SBW) damage demonstrated that the impact on yield is dependent upon the number of buds lost, their position on the inflorescence and cultivar.
